Per session 17 Skills are progressive disclosure: only the name and description are preloaded; the body loads when the skill is used.
When invoked 2,260 The whole file, excluding the scripts and references it only reads on demand.
Security scan A 0 findings. A grade says what 26 rules found in the file — not that it is safe.
Origin 94% copy Near-identical to another mod in the catalogue.
Token cost

What it costs to keep this loaded

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

subagent-driven-development sc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 7d ago.

A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.

Nothing flagged

None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Subagent-Driven Development

Execute plan by dispatching fresh subagent per task, with two-stage review after each: spec compliance review first, then code quality review.

Core principle: Fresh subagent per task + two-stage review (spec then quality) = high quality, fast iteration

When to Use

digraph when_to_use {
    "Have implementation plan?" [shape=diamond];
    "Tasks mostly independent?" [shape=diamond];
    "Stay in this session?" [shape=diamond];
    "subagent-driven-development" [shape=box];
    "executing-plans" [shape=box];
    "Manual execution or brainstorm first" [shape=box];

    "Have implementation plan?" -> "Tasks mostly independent?" [label="yes"];
    "Have implementation plan?" -> "Manual execution or brainstorm first" [label="no"];
    "Tasks mostly independent?" -> "Stay in this session?" [label="yes"];
    "Tasks mostly independent?" -> "Manual execution or brainstorm first" [label="no - tightly coupled"];
    "Stay in this session?" -> "subagent-driven-development" [label="yes"];
    "Stay in this session?" -> "executing-plans" [label="no - parallel session"];
}

vs. Executing Plans (parallel session):

  • Same session (no context switch)
  • Fresh subagent per task (no context pollution)
  • Two-stage review after each task: spec compliance first, then code quality
  • Faster iteration (no human-in-loop between tasks)
